Oracle编程基础:PL/SQL详解与实战

需积分: 10 1 下载量 70 浏览量 更新于2024-07-19 收藏 414KB PPTX 举报
"Oracle编程基础,包括PL/SQL语言和控制语句的介绍,强调了PL/SQL的结构、注释方法以及基本规则" Oracle数据库是企业级的重要数据存储和管理工具,对于IT专业人士而言,掌握Oracle编程是必备技能之一。本章重点介绍了Oracle编程的基础,特别是PL/SQL这一Oracle特有的编程语言。PL/SQL结合了SQL的查询能力与过程式编程语言的特点,使得开发者能够编写复杂的数据库应用程序。 1. PL/SQL简介 PL/SQL是Oracle公司在SQL基础上扩展的一种编程语言,它允许用户定义变量、数据类型、函数和过程,支持流程控制语句,包含SQL语句,以及进行错误处理。通过PL/SQL,可以实现对数据库的高效和灵活访问,执行批量数据处理,创建自定义功能等。 2. PL/SQL基本结构 PL/SQL的结构基于块,主要包含函数、过程和匿名块。一个完整的PL/SQL块由声明部分、执行部分和异常处理部分组成。例如,一个简单的输出语句块可以由声明一个变量,赋值,然后使用DBMS_OUTPUT.PUT_LINE函数来显示。 3. PL/SQL注释 注释在编程中起到解释代码作用,提高代码可读性。PL/SQL支持单行注释(以两个连字符“- -”开始)和多行注释(以“/*”开始,“*/”结束)。通过注释,开发者可以清晰地解释代码的功能和目的。 4. PL/SQL基本规则 - 字符集:PL/SQL允许使用字母(大小写)、数字、空格、回车符以及多种数学和间隔符。 - 标识符:不区分大小写,仅允许字母、数字和下划线,且必须以字母开头。 - 语句结束:语句通常以分号";"结束。 - 引用:字符型和日期型常量需要使用单引号或双引号括起。 - 关键词和标识符:PL/SQL的关键字和标识符应遵循特定的命名规则,避免冲突。 了解并熟练掌握这些基础概念是成为Oracle数据库专家的第一步。通过深入学习PL/SQL,开发者能够编写高效、可维护的数据库脚本,实现对Oracle数据库的复杂操作和管理。在实际工作中,结合控制语句,如IF-THEN-ELSE、CASE、LOOP等,可以实现动态逻辑,满足各种业务需求。因此,对于希望在Oracle领域深化的专业人士来说,熟悉和精通PL/SQL编程至关重要。